WebAs adjectives the difference between nematic and paranematic is that nematic is (physics chemistry of certain liquid crystals) whose molecules align in loose parallel lines while paranematic is (chemistry physics) describing the production of nematic order in a liquid crystal under the influence of an applied magnetic field.
